零基础学Python多久能独立写代码?——全面解析学习路径与时间规划
在当今这个数字化时代,编程技能已成为一项极具价值的资产,而Python作为最受欢迎的编程语言之一,以其简洁易学的语法、强大的功能库以及广泛的应用领域,吸引了无数零基础的学习者投身其中,对于刚踏入编程大门的新手而言,“零基础学Python多久能独立写代码?”这一疑问无疑是最为关心的话题,本文将从学习路径、个人因素、有效学习方法及时间规划等方面进行全面解析,帮助你更清晰地规划自己的学习旅程。

理解“独立写代码”的含义
我们需要明确“独立写代码”的定义,对于初学者而言,这可能意味着能够不依赖外部帮助,根据自己的需求设计并实现简单的程序或脚本,比如自动化处理数据、构建基础的Web应用或进行简单的数据分析等,随着技能的提升,“独立”的层次也会逐渐加深,涵盖更复杂的项目和问题解决能力。
学习路径概览
零基础学习Python,大致可以分为以下几个阶段:
- 基础语法学习:包括变量、数据类型、控制结构(条件语句、循环)、函数、模块等基本概念。
- 核心库掌握:如NumPy、Pandas用于数据处理,Matplotlib、Seaborn用于数据可视化,以及Flask、Django等Web框架。
- 项目实战:通过实际项目应用所学知识,如开发一个个人博客、数据分析报告或自动化脚本。
- 深入学习与优化:学习算法、设计模式、性能优化等高级主题,提升代码质量和效率。
个人因素影响学习速度
- 学习时间投入:每天投入的学习时间越多,进步自然越快。
- 编程背景:有其它编程语言基础的学习者可能会更快上手。
- 解决问题能力:面对错误和挑战时的解决策略,直接影响学习效率。
- 学习资源选择:优质的教程、书籍和社区支持能加速学习进程。
有效学习方法
- 理论与实践结合:边学边做,通过小项目巩固知识点。
- 参与社区互动:加入Python学习社群,提问、解答,与他人交流心得。
- 持续挑战自我:完成基础学习后,尝试解决更复杂的问题,参与开源项目。
- 定期复习总结:定期回顾所学,整理笔记,加深理解。
时间规划建议
- 短期目标(1-3个月):掌握基础语法,完成一些简单的编程练习和小项目,如计算器、文本处理工具等。
- 中期目标(3-6个月):深入学习核心库,开始参与更复杂的项目,如数据分析项目或小型Web应用开发。
- 长期目标(6个月以上):达到独立开发水平,能够根据需求设计并实现较为复杂的系统,同时开始探索算法、性能优化等高级主题。
总体来看,从零基础到能够独立编写Python代码,大多数学习者可能需要3至6个月的时间,但这并非绝对,学习速度受多种因素影响,包括个人的学习效率、投入时间、学习方法以及是否持续实践等,重要的是保持耐心,享受学习过程中的每一次小成就,不断挑战自己,逐步提升,编程是一项技能,而非一蹴而就的知识,持续的学习和实践是通往精通之路的关键。
通过上述规划与努力,你将逐步发现,自己已能自信地面对编程挑战,独立编写出满足需求的Python代码,开启属于你的数字化创造之旅。
未经允许不得转载! 作者:python1991知识网,转载或复制请以超链接形式并注明出处Python1991知识网。
原文地址:https://www.python1991.cn/4731.html发布于:2026-03-01





